Collard Greens with Ham Hock

Collard greens cooked with ham hock is a classic Southern dish. This collard greens with ham hock recipe is deeply flavorful and savory. We cook the hardy collard greens in a broth that is smoky, meaty, and rich. The resulting collard greens dish is a delicious balance of flavors between the savory ham, mildly bitter collard greens, and spices.

Collard Greens With Ham Hock

Prep Time10 minutes
Cook Time2 hours
Course: Side Dish
Cuisine: American
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 2 bunches Collard Greens
  • 1 ea Small Yellow Onion
  • 2 Tbsp Olive Oil/Lard/Bacon Grease
  • 3 ea Garlic Cloves
  • 2 tsp Salt
  • 1 tsp Brown sugar
  • 1/2 tsp Crushed Red Pepper
  • 1 Tbsp Apple Cider Vinegar
  • 2 Lbs. Ham Hock
  • 6-7 cups Chicken Broth
  • Hot sauce, seasoned salt optional

Instructions

  • Dice and sauté Onion until translucent about 3 mins
  • Add garlic and seasonings cook for 30 secs.
  • Add Ham and cover with broth cook covered for one hour.
  • Remove collards from the stem and chop into one inch strips.
  • Add greens to simmering broth cover and cook on low for one hour.
  • Remove ham hock from broth. Carefully, shred the ham hock from the bone using a fork. Return the shredded meat back into the pot.
  • Add additional hot sauce or seasoned salt if desired. Serve and Enjoy!
